Reflections in Verse, Volume 8: Ink of Conscience - Paperback
by Khalilah H. Purnell (Author)
Reflections in Verse, Volume 8, "Ink of Conscience", is a profound and thought-provoking collection of poetry that serves as a voice for the voiceless, a call for justice, and a reflection of society's most pressing issues.
This book explores themes of systemic inequity, wrongful convictions, prejudice, and the urgent need for reform and accountability.
Written with raw emotion, deep authenticity, and poetic precision, Ink of Conscience weaves together stories of struggle, resilience, and hope. Each poem challenges readers to reflect on the injustices that exist in the world while igniting a call to action for change.
